A regulated power supply is an embedded circuit that converts unregulated AC voltage or current to a constant DC. A regulated power supply is also called a linear power supply. A step-down transformer, rectifier, DC filter, regulator are the basic building blocks of regulated DC power supply.

The blocks that regulated the DC power supply consist of filter and rectifier circuit, transformer, and voltage regulator circuit. The fixed voltage regulators have three terminals they are input, output, and ground terminals. Both fixed and adjustable voltage regulators are three-terminal fixed voltage regulators.

The IC voltage regulator, Zener diode, SMPS, and transistorized series are the commonly used type of voltage regulators. The advantages of linear power supplies are they have low noise levels, they are reliable and simple, and the cost is low.

The linear regulated power supply and switching mode power supply are the categories of power supplies.
